Abstract
The thesis entitled "Solid Waste Management in Ratnanagar Municipality -1 Chitwan
District" highlights the situation of solid waste management practices in study area.
General objective of this study is to analyze the situation of solid waste management
in Ratnanagar municipality ward no 1. Specific objectives are to examine the current
solid waste management system in the study area. Both analytical and descriptive
research design were used to complete of this study. Quantitative data were analyzed
by using analytical research design and qualitative data were analyzed by using
qualitative research design and find out the situation of solid waste management
situation of the study area. Ratnanagar municipality ward no 1 is Tandi Bazzar area is
the sample site of this study. Total population of the wards is 4999 (CBS Report,
2011). In main highway lines there are 201 households among them 25% households
(50) were taken as sample household. From each household single individual was
taken for interview by busing random sampling method. The present study was based
both primary and secondary data. Secondary data were used in literature review and
that were collected through library study method and books, article, journal, previous
thesis are used as the main sources of secondary data. Primary data were collected
from the field by using various data collection techniques such as questionnaires and
observation.
Solid wastes are a growing environmental problem in the study area. Increase in
population along with the rapid urbanization has led to the increase in waste
generation rate in the study area. Furthermore, change in living standard of the people
and change in food habit have increased the rate of inorganic waste. All these have
added to the problems in solid waste management which is a global issue. The major
sources of solid waste in Ratnanagar municipality are municipal, domestic,
commercial and agricultural, which consists of both organic and inorganic. The total
waste generated in Study area has been increasing day by day.
The citizen should be encouraged by the authority for the segregation of wastes at
household level. They shall promote recycling or reuse of segregated materials. Waste
minimization efforts should be motivated at the primary and secondary levels of waste
collection. The citizen should be encouraged by the authority for the segregation of

waste at household level and for composting of waste for stabilization of wastes. The
concerned authorities should adopt suitable technology, a combination of such
technologies to make use of wastes so as to minimum burden on landfill. Landfill
should be restricted to non-biodegradable and other wastes that are not suitable either
for recycling or for biological processing. The concerned authority has to appoint
more employees in order to extend their service area. Community participation should
be increased and local NGOs should be mobilized in solid waste management. Gap
between staffs within the municipality should be omitted so that ongoing event inside
the municipality could be easily known and should take responsibility on the people’s
work inside municipality i.e. institutional strengthen should be establish.
